Dragons v Connacht - RaboDirect PRO12 match preview
Newport Gwent Dragons will reward Jack Dixon and Ieuan Jones will places on the bench to face Connacht on Friday.

Wales Under-20s international Dixon and Jones impressed in the LV=Cup games over the past fortnight, so will be looking to make their most of their inclusion against Connacht.
The Dragons have also named Lewis Evans and Phil Price in their line-up for the return to league action.
Connacht have made just the three just changes from the side that beat Benetton Treviso 18-3 in their last league outing.
Captain Gavin Duffy, Mick Kearney and Michael Swift all return, with Ethienne Reynecke named on the bench.
Also among the replacements, flying winger Matt Healy could earn his first cap after impressing for the second string.
Dragons: 15 Tom Prydie, 14 Will Harries, 13 Pat Leach, 12 Ashley Smith, 11 Tonderai Chavhanga, 10 Dan Evans, 9 Wayne Evans, 1 Phil Price, 2 Hugh Gustafson, 3 Dan Way, 4 Adam Jones, 5 Rob Sidoli, 6 Lewis Evans (capt), 7 Nic Cudd, 8 Tom Brown.
Replacements: 16 Steve Jones, 17 Owen Evans, 18 Nathan Buck, 19 Ian Nimmo, 20 Ieuan Jones, 21 Jonathan Evans, 22 Lewis Robling, 23 Jack Dixon.
Connacht: 15 Robbie Henshaw, 14 Tiernan O'Halloran, 13 Danie Poolman, 12 Dave McSharry, 11 Gavin Duffy (captain), 10 Dan Parks, 9 Kieran Marmion, 1 Denis Buckley, 2 Jason Harris-Wright, 3 Nathan White, 4 Michael Swift, 5 Mick Kearney, 6 Andrew Browne, 7 Willie Faloon, 8 Eoin McKeon.
Replacements: 16 Ethienne Reynecke, 17 Rodney Ah You, 18 Ronan Loughney, 19 Dave Gannon, 20 Johnny O'Connor, 21 David Moore, 22 Miah Nikora, 23 Matt Healy
